as posted by the channel#AskAna makes its debut in this neverbeforeseen TwitterStorm! Ana Kasparian () responds to viewer questions from Twitterboth personal and serious. You can join in by using #askana and #tytlive on Twitter! As always, use #askcenk and keep the questions coming.
This week: What would Ana do if she was boss? What are her hobbies? What her Master's in Political Science worth it? Do Ana and Cenk hang out? How would life be different if she'd never worked at TYT? Does Feminism go overboard? Who else would Ana like to co-host with besides Cenk? Free restaurants?
